Why choose enthalpy heat recovery?

An enthalpy exchanger does not create moisture, but it can return a portion of the moisture from the exhaust air back into the interior. This helps mitigate excessive drying of the indoor air during the heating season.

In normal operation, indoor humidity will not increase immediately. The enthalpy exchanger works gradually – moisture is returned continuously, and the final effect depends on the specific house, the ventilation regime, the outdoor temperature, the humidity of the exhaust air, and the absorbency of building materials.

The practical result is a more pleasant indoor climate, less feeling of dry air, higher living comfort, and at the same time maintaining a hygienic air exchange.

12-year warranty on casing tightness

We offer an above-standard 12-year warranty on the airtightness of the casing of RECUBOX® units.

The casing is made of high-quality polypropylene and joined using hot gas welding technology, which creates homogeneous, strong, and long-term stable joints without the risk of degradation.

Unlike designs using glued joints, sealing tapes, or combinations of different materials, the RECUBOX® maintains its airtightness and mechanical resistance even after many years of operation.

A huge advantage of the CONSTANT FLOW technology is the ability of the fans to automatically respond to changes in pressure drops in the system and adjust the speed so that a stable air flow is maintained in the long term.

In addition, the fans are very suitable for smart homes – thanks to the 0–10 V control, they can be easily connected to, for example, Loxone, Home Assistant, and other intelligent systems.

100% BY-PASS

RECUBOX® can also be supplied in a variant with a 100% mechanical BY-PASS.

This system closes the passage of fresh air through the exchanger in an instant, and at the same time opens a bypass channel behind the exchanger.

The advantage is that even with an active BY-PASS, the air remains filtered by the same filter as during normal operation through the exchanger.

Final dimensions of the version with BY-PASS

The integrated 100% BY-PASS is located behind the exchanger and creates a separate bypass channel for the supply of fresh air.

For versions with an integrated BY-PASS, it is therefore necessary to take into account an increase in the final dimensions of the RECUBOX®. The depth of the unit increases by approximately the dimension of the connecting flange, and depending on the specific configuration, the width of the unit may also increase.

The final dimension of the RECUBOX® with an integrated 100% BY-PASS always depends on the selected variant of the spigots, the size of the connecting flanges, the orientation of the unit, and the specific installation requirement.

BY-PASS control

The control of the BY-PASS is handled via a DN14 shaft, which is brought out of the RECUBOX® to its outer wall.

In the basic version, it is equipped with a manual control handle, which can be easily replaced with a servomotor. This is anchored with a screw into an installation plate fixed with four metric screws.

Integrated 100% BY-PASS RECUBOX

What is the BY-PASS used for?

The BY-PASS in the RECUBOX® serves to allow the air in certain situations to bypass the heat recovery exchanger without transferring heat.

It is most often used in the summer: if it is cooler outside at night than inside the house, the heat recovery opens the BY-PASS and the cool outdoor air flows directly into the interior without being heated by the exhaust air. Thanks to this, natural night cooling of the building can occur, and with filtered air, which is important e.g. for allergy sufferers.

The second important use is the protection of the exchanger against freezing. At very low outdoor temperatures, the control system can temporarily open the BY-PASS, which defrosts the exchanger and prevents damage to it.

Simply put: The BY-PASS is a "bypass" of the heat recovery exchanger that allows intelligent control of when heat should be transferred and when not.
